Tommy Balcetis joined the
after initially working for the NBA in Europe and Africa, where he managed media rights distribution. His transition to the Nuggets came through a connection with Tim Connelly, then the New Orleans Pelicans assistant GM, whom Balcetis met at a Basketball Without Borders event in Moscow. When Connelly took over the Nuggets front office in 2013, he brought Balcetis on board to help build the organization's analytics capabilities from the ground up, as the NBA was just beginning to embrace advanced data analytics in team-building.
Over the years, Balcetis climbed the ranks within the Nuggets organization, evolving from managing basketball analytics to becoming Assistant GM in 2020. He played a vital role in shaping the Nuggets' roster, including supporting the general manager in key decisions that led to the team's 2023 NBA championship. Despite his long service and contributions, Tommy Balcetis was passed over for the general manager position after the firing of Calvin Booth in 2025. Instead, Ben Tenzer, a Denver Nuggets veteran front-office member with over 15 years of experience and a strong background in salary cap expertise, was named interim GM. Tenzer also serves as GM of the Nuggets' G League affiliate, the Grand Rapids Gold, and is considered a leading candidate for the permanent GM role.

The Nuggets owner, Josh Kroenke, has taken an active role in the front office during this transitional period, serving as interim president of basketball operations and overseeing the search for a new GM. Kroenke has emphasized the importance of maintaining the team's competitive edge while balancing input from star players like Jokić, though ultimate decisions rest with the front office.

Gabrielle Union shared Dwyane Wade's actual banana boat signing moment The banana boat has long been part of Dwyane Wade's public lore. Back in 2015, Wade, Gabrielle Union, LeBron James , and Chris Paul vacationed in the Bahamas. During that trip, they were photographed riding an inflatable banana boat, a photo that instantly went viral and became an internet sensation. Despite its global reach, Wade insists it wasn't meant to be seen. Gabrielle Union shared Dwyane Wade's banana boat signing incident. Gabrielle Union also had fun with the moment. She once revealed that it was her idea to go on the banana boat in the first place, unknowingly setting the stage for one of the most talked-about images in sports pop culture. The "Banana Boat Crew" eventually became an unofficial nickname for Wade, LeBron, Chris Paul, and Carmelo Anthony, even though Anthony wasn't in the original photo. 'Melo showed up late,' Wade said. 'Had he been there on time, he'd be in it too.'
